Breast Augmentation

Breast augmentation is a surgical procedure that enhances the size and shape of the breast by placing an implant beneath the existing breast tissue. There are many variables to consider when considering breast enhancement. The existing size and shape of the breast, the shape and size of the chest and body, whether or not there is laxity of the existing tissue, the symmetry of the breasts, and the desired increase in size.

Other considerations when thinking about breast augmentation are the type of implants that can be used. The first is the saline implant. With this type of implant, saline ( salt water ) is used to fill the implant. The other option is silicone gel. The silicone implant is filled with a viscous silicone polymer which creates a more natural feel. Both of these implants are FDA approved. During the consultation, Dr. Franco will discuss the pros and cons of each type of implant to determine which implant is right for you.

Another factor to consider is whether or not a breast lift is necessary at the time of placement of the implant. A breast lift is technically called a mastopexy. With age and after pregnancy the breast tissue develops laxity and sags. It is sometimes necessary to lift the breast at the same time as augmentation to achieve the desired shape and contour. Examination at the time of the consult will determine whether or not this is necessary.

Once these factors are determined then the approach for placement of the implant can be determined. Most commonly an incision is made just beneath the breast to place the implant. This can be hidden in the fold beneath the breast. Another option is to make an incision around the nipple. This most commonly is done when in conjunction with lifting the breast.
